Šablony dokumentů Vám slouží ke snadnému vytváření nových dokumentů. Administrátor pomocí těchto šablon může snadno přidávat položky do menu, přidávat novinky na firemní web či články do blogu a tak dále. Nemusí se přitom starat o vyplňování poměrně rozsáhlého nastavení souboru - většinou stačí vyplnit jméno, text a o zbytek se postará právě zvolená šablona.
Použití již hotových šablon je vysvětleno v sekci Začínáme, na tomto místě si popíšeme vytváření nových šablon.
Nastavení šablony
Nastavení je velice podobné nastvení běžných dokumentů (což je logické - toto nastavení se používá pro přednastavení nových článků. Nastavení nicméně není kompletně identické. Položky, které se jednoduše nepřekopírují do na základě šablony nově vytvářeného článku, ale mají zvláštní chování jsou v následující tabulce zdůrazněny.
| Informace o šabloně | |
|---|---|
| Jméno šablony | Jméno šablony se zobrazí v nabídce šablon. Na výsledný článek nemá vliv. |
| Autor šablony | Má pouze informativní charakter o tom, který administrátor šablonu vytvořil. Na výsledný článek nemá vliv. |
| Poznámka | Poznámka může vysvětlit, k jakému účelu šablona slouží. Zobrazí se při výběru šablony. Na výsledný článek nemá vliv. |
| Vytvořeno | Datum vytvoření šablony. Má pouze informativní charakter. Na výsledný článek nemá vliv. |
| Poslední úpravy | Datum poslední uložené změny šablony. Má pouze informativní charakter. Na výsledný článek nemá vliv. |
| Nastavení | |
| Text anotace | Text anotace, který se použije jako výchozí při použití této šablony. |
| Nadřazený článek |
Toto je velice důležité nastavení, které se může chovat dvojím způsobem. Vybereme-li konkrétní nadřazený článek, šablona vždy nastaví tento článek, tak jak bychom očekávali. Nezáleží na tom, odkud je volána (v rámci stromu dokumentů můžete použít tuto šablonu kdekoliv a výsledkem bude vždy tento výchozí nadřazený článek). Toto nastavení se hodí např. pro články v jednotlivých rubrikách - ať zvolíme šablonu kdekoliv, zařadí se nový dokument na správné místo. Vybereme-li ovšem volbu Automaticky, záleží na tom, na jakém místě ve stromu dokumentů danou šablonu voláme - použije se totiž aktuální nadřazený článek. Toto nastavení se hodí především pro generování stránek v menu - ostatní nastavení chceme stejné, nicméně umístění jednotlivých položek menu se pochopitelně liší. |
| Téma/rubrika | Nastaví výchozí rubriku. |
| Kapitola | Výchozí hodnota kapitoly. |
| Externí odkaz |
Je-li použit externí odkaz, nebudou odkazy vést na tento dokument ale ve skutečnosti na zadané url. Doporučuje se příliš nepoužívat a v šablonách nemá příliš smysl (patrně nebudete vytvářet více stránek vedoucích mimo váš web). Toto nastavení je tu pouze pro úplnost. |
| Přesměrování |
Podobné jako externí odkaz, ale přesměrování proběhne v rámci vašeho webu. Rovněž platí poznámka o tom, že se nedoporučuje příliš používat a když už, tak ne v rámci šablony, ale až výsledného dokumentu. |
| Povolit HTML export | Nastaví, je-li možno článek exportovat do statického html souboru pomocí funkce Exportovat. |
| Obrázek | Výchozí ilustrační obrázek. Použije se například v náhledech článků. Doporučuje se nějaká menší ilustrační ikona. |
| Podrobné nastavení | |
| Typ článku |
Nastaví typ článku/dokumentu v rámci administrace. Povolené hodnoty jsou:
Pro drtivou většinu běžných dokumentů ponechte nastavení "Dokument". |
| XHTML šablona | Výchozí XHTML šablona, která bude použita k formátování výsledného dokumentu. |
| Jazyk | Informace o jazyku, ve kterém je dokument napsán (resp. o jazykové verzi, ve které se daný dokument nachází). |
| Zobrazit v menu | Definuje, jestli se daný dokument přidá do vygenerovaného menu. |
| Uzamčeno | Uzamčené články mohou editovat pouze uživatelé se zvláštními přístupovými právy - proto se v rámci šablon doporučuje články spíše nezamykat. |
| Aktivní článek | Definuje, je-li článek na webu aktivní. Doporučuje se nechat nastaveno na Ne a aktivovat až skutečně hotové články - můžete tak šablonu použít pro vytváření článků, které se uložením nezobrazí na webu a povolit jejich zobrazení až po následné korektuře. |
| Aktivní od | Je-li nastavené datum a čas, článek se před tímto datem chová jako neaktivní (tzn. že tato položka ovlivňuje článek založený na této šabloně, nikoliv samotnou šablonu) |
| Aktivní do | Je-li nastavené datum a čas, článek se po tomto datu chová jako neaktivní (tzn. že tato položka ovlivňuje článek založený na této šabloně, nikoliv samotnou šablonu) |
| Uživatelské proměnné |
Proměnné, které se dají použít v šablonách pro speciální podmínky. Je-li více proměnných, oddělují se středníkem. Formát vypadá následovně: promenna;promenna2=nějaký text;promenna3=false. Tento zápis znamená: promenna má hodnotu true, promenna2 má hodnotu "nějaký text" a promenna3 je nastavena na false. |
| Klíčová slova | Klíčová slova se přidají ke klíčovým slovům celého webu (patřičné jazykové verze). Můžete tak pro jednotlivé dokument/šablony vytvářet různé skupiny klíčových slov a lépe cílit SEO optimalizaci. |
| Zobrazení | |
| Zobrazit anotaci | Nastaví, má-li se anotace zobrazit také v záhlaví článku. Pokud ne, použije se anotace jen pro generování přehledů článků. |
| Zobrazit nadpis článku | Nastaví, má-li se automaticky přidávat nadpis článku (do značky h2). |
| Povolit HTML | Normálně Ano - pokud ne, bude text naformátován pouze tvrdými mezerami na koncích odstavců apod. - ostatní formátování bude ignorováno. |
| Povolit komentáře |
Nastaví způsob zobrazení komentářů. Ano - komentáře jsou aktivní Ne - komentáře se nezobrazí Uzamčeno - komentáře se zobrazí, ale nové přidávat nelze. |
| Formát výpisu komentářů |
Možnosti jsou následující: Výchozí - záleží na nastavení celého webu Lineární výpis - nejstarší => nejnovější Lineární výpis - nejnovější => nejstarší Hierarchický výpis - nejstarší => nejnovější Hierarchický výpis - nejnovější => nejstarší |
| Zobrazit obsah seriálu |
Automaticky - systém rozpoznává seriály automaticky - doporučeno. Ano - systém se pokusí zobrazit obsah, i když o seriál nejde. Ne - systém obsah seriálu nezobrazí. |
| Zobrazit související | Nastaví, má-li systém hledat a nabízet související články. |
| Zobrazit hodnocení | Umožní zobrazení hodnocení a hlasování pro daný článek. |
| Zobrazit v archivu | Nastaví, má-li se výsledný dokument zobrazovat v archivu článků (dokumenty, který mají charakter článků by se měly v archivu zobrazovat, dokumenty které mají charakter "statické stránky", by v něm být neměly). |
| Zobrazit v mapě stránek | Je-li povoleno, zobrazí se dokument v mapě stránek. Standardně ano, kromě "článků". Většinou má smysl tuto položku nastavit na Ano a předchozí na Ne (a opačně). |
| Umožnit zasílání e-mailem | Umožní přidat formulář pro zaslání "upoutávky" na článek mailem. |
| Zahrnovat mezi nejčtenější | Pokud ne, nebude dokument zahrnován mezi statistiky nejčtenějších článků. Nastvujte na Ano u dokumentů typu "článek". |
| Přístup | |
| Uživatelská úroveň | Minimální uživatelská úroveň pro zobrazení článku. |
| Heslo | Je-li zadáno heslo, bude vyžadováno před zobrazením článku. |
| Pomocná otázka | Případná nápověda k heslu. |
| Placený článek | Uživatelé, kteří mají zaplacený poplatek článek mohou číst - ostatní nikoliv. |
Text šablony
Většinou sice budete věnovat při tvorbě šablony pozornost hlavně nastavení proměnných, nicméně ani pole pro zadání "obsahu článku" není v šabloně omylem. Naopak - můžete tak vytvářet skutečné šablony dokumentů. Můžete mít například naformátované tabulky, do nichž jen vyplníte hodnoty, předdefinovanou strukturu dokumentů, které mají mít stejný formát, nebo dokonce vytvořit dokumenty, jejichž formátování je za hranicemi schopností WYSIWYG editoru (vícero sloupců apod.) a tyto pak vyplňovat bez nutnosti opakované přímé editace XHTML zdrojového kódu.